Flank Steak Recipe With Mustard Sauce

Easy Flank Steak Recipe made in 10 minutes with a tangy wine and mustard sauce. Easy enough to make on a weeknight and elegant enough to serve with company

Ingredients

For Steak

  • 2 lb Flank Steak
  • Salt + Pepper

For Mustard Sauce

  • 1/2 cup Onions sliced (about 1/4 onion)
  • 1 teaspoon Dijon Mustard
  • 1/2 teaspoon Thyme can be dried
  • 1/2 cup Beef Stock
  • 1/4 cup White Wine
  • Salt + Pepper
  • 1 teaspoon Olive Oil

Instructions

  1. To Cook the beef:
  2. Preheat the Broiler for 5 minutes
  3. Place beef in a broiler rack and add salt + pepper on both sides
  4. Cook for 3 minutes on one side, then turn and cook for 3 more minutes
  5. To Make the Pan Sauce
  6. While the beef is cooking, heat a saute pan over medium heat and add the olive oil
  7. Cook the onions with a little salt and the thyme until softened
  8. Add the wine, mustard, and stock and let it reduce over medium-low heat until thickened (do not let it dry)

  9. Enjoy!
